FMC410 -
Sundance Multiprocessor Technology Ltd.
The FMC410 is an optical transceiver module in the FMC form factor that offers ten independent optical transmit and receive links with maximum data rates of either 6.25Gbps or 10Gbps. This COTS card provides high-speed optical input and output for telecommunications, data networking, data storage, and ultra-high-definition video applications. The FMC410 can also be used as a dual 10Gb or dual 40Gb Ethernet port.

Elbit Systems of America®
Tactical Video Data Link (TVDL) is a video and data receiver/transmitter system specially designed for attack helicopters. This compact and lightweight system, weighing less than 4 kg, enables real-time, high-quality video imagery and data captured by UAV payloads or ground-based sensors to be displayed directly to the aircrew. This saves the need for lengthy radio dialogue by creating a common visual language amongst all forces in the battlespace and dramatically shortening the sensor-to-shooter loop. As a true video relay, the system can simultaneously transmit video and data as well as deliver imagery captured by onboard payloads to tactical forces for enhanced coordination and battle management.

Teledyne LeCroy
Compute Express Link (CXL) is a new high-speed CPU-to-Device and CPU-to-Memory interconnect designed to accelerate next-generation data center performance. CXL technology maintains memory coherency between the CPU memory space and memory on attached devices, which allows resource sharing for higher performance, reduced software stack complexity, and lower overall system cost. This permits users to simply focus on target workloads as opposed to the redundant memory management hardware in their accelerators. CXL is based on a PCI Express 5.0 Physical layer with speeds up to 32GT/s. Teledyne LeCroy provides protocol analysis test equipment to support development and debug of CXL based devices.

Cyton-CXP -
BitFlow, Inc.
CoaXPress (CXP) is a simple, yet powerful, standard for moving high speed serial data from a camera to a frame grabber. Video is captured at speeds of up to 6.25 Gigabits/Second (Gb/S). Simultaneously, control commands and triggers can be sent to the camera 20 Mb/S (with a trigger accuracy of +/- 2 nanoseconds). Up to 13 W of power can also supplied to the camera.

NI
The Camera Link Adapter Module for FlexRIO supports 80‐bit, 10‐tap base‐, medium‐, and full‐configuration image acquisition from Camera Link 1.2 standard cameras. You can pair the Camera Link Adapter Module for FlexRIO with a PXI FPGA Module for FlexRIO for applications that require bit‐level processing and very low system latency. With the Camera Link Adapter Module for FlexRIO, you can use the FPGA to process images from the camera in-line before sending the images to the CPU, enabling more advanced preprocessing architectures.

Listen -
WinTECH Software Design
Listen is a Data Link monitor designed to assist debugging & troubleshooting serial communications links. Listen utilizes standard Windows COM port drivers to tap into RS-232 transmit signals for monitoring bi-directional communications between two devices.
